DBB 80 Valve: Power and Reliability for Demanding Operations
The DBB 80 valve is designed to offer dual isolation and a bleed mechanism in a single, space-efficient valve body. With pressure ratings exceeding 80 bar, this valve is built for applications where safety, reliability, and minimal leakage are mission-critical.
Key Features:
-
High-Pressure Rating: Suitable for pressure applications up to and beyond 80 bar
-
Forged Body Construction: Enhances strength, corrosion resistance, and long-term reliability
-
Sealing Options: Metal or soft seats with graphite backup for fire-safe performance
-
Compliance: Meets industry standards including API 607 and ISO 10497 for fire safety
Common Applications:
-
Oil and gas pipelines and compressor stations
-
Offshore process skids and subsea modules
-
Refineries, heat exchangers, and furnace isolation systems
-
Petrochemical product transfer and pressure testing loops
Engineers rely on the DBB 80 valve to eliminate the need for multiple isolation points, reducing installation time, minimizing leak paths, and ensuring safer maintenance cycles. Its compact, rugged design makes it a preferred choice for areas with limited space or high risk.
DBB 80D Valve: Compact Precision for Instrumentation Systems
The DBB 80D is a specialized variant of the DBB valve family. Built for use in control panels, sampling lines, and field instrumentation setups, this ultra-compact valve delivers the same performance excellence as its larger counterpart—but in a much smaller form.
Technical Highlights:
-
Pressure Handling: Up to 80 bar, ideal for instrumentation and control systems
-
One-Piece Body: Forged for strength and leak-tight performance
-
Connection Types: NPT, BSPT, compression tube ends, and flanged options
-
Mounting Flexibility: Suited for panel-mount and skid installations
-
Fire-Safe & Emission Compliant: Built to meet global industry standards
Ideal Use Cases:
-
Analyzer isolation in petrochemical plants
-
Pressure transmitter protection in remote stations
-
Sampling systems in pharmaceutical and food-grade processing
-
Compact flow calibration loops in cleanroom environments
With minimized dead volume and high-pressure capabilities, the DBB 80D ensures that instruments can be safely removed or calibrated without shutting down the system—improving uptime and reducing operational costs.
DBB 80 vs. DBB 80D: Choosing the Right Valve
| Feature | DBB 80 | DBB 80D |
|---|---|---|
| Pressure Rating | 80+ bar | Up to 80 bar |
| Application Scale | Full-scale pipeline/process | Compact instrumentation systems |
| Body Construction | Heavy-duty forged body | Ultra-compact forged body |
| Typical Use Cases | Isolation in harsh field conditions | Analyzer loops, control panels |
| Mounting | Flanged or threaded inline | Panel-mount or tube fitting |
The choice between DBB 80 and DBB 80D depends on the application's scale and physical constraints. Both offer top-tier sealing, pressure handling, and compliance features, ensuring performance even in mission-critical systems.
